使用MySQL实现本地文件浏览

在日常开发和管理中,我们经常需要对本地文件进行浏览和管理。而MySQL作为一种流行的数据库管理系统,也可以用来实现本地文件的浏览功能。本文将介绍如何使用MySQL来实现本地文件浏览,并提供相应的代码示例。

实现方式

我们可以通过在MySQL中创建一个存储过程,来实现对本地文件的浏览。这个存储过程将使用MySQL提供的sys_exec()函数来执行系统命令,从而达到浏览本地文件的目的。

下面是实现本地文件浏览的基本步骤:

1. 创建存储过程

首先,我们需要在MySQL中创建一个存储过程,用于执行系统命令来浏览本地文件。下面是示例代码:

```sql
DELIMITER $$

CREATE PROCEDURE list_files()
BEGIN
    DECLARE cmd VARCHAR(255);
    SET cmd = 'ls /path/to/files'; -- 替换为你要浏览的文件路径
    SELECT sys_exec(cmd);
END$$

DELIMITER ;

在上面的示例中,我们创建了一个名为list_files的存储过程,其中使用sys_exec()函数执行系统命令ls /path/to/files来浏览指定路径下的文件列表。

2. 调用存储过程

接下来,我们可以通过调用这个存储过程来实现本地文件的浏览。下面是调用存储过程的示例代码:

CALL list_files();

通过执行上述代码,我们即可在MySQL中实现对指定路径下文件的浏览,方便管理和查看本地文件。

流程图

下面是实现本地文件浏览的流程图:

flowchart TD
    A(创建存储过程) --> B(调用存储过程)

总结

通过本文的介绍,我们了解了如何使用MySQL实现本地文件的浏览。通过创建存储过程并调用系统命令,我们可以方便地在MySQL中查看本地文件的列表。这种方法可以方便地与数据库管理和查询结合,提高工作效率。

希望本文对大家有所帮助,欢迎尝试并探索更多关于MySQL的应用场景。如果有任何问题或疑问,欢迎在评论区留言交流讨论。感谢阅读!